Six-Month check-up
We saw Dr. Dudgeon today for Addie's six-month check-up. Dr. Dudgeon was very happy with Addie's development and he hopes she continues to surprise everyone. Today was the most routine visit that we have had - all went as well as I could have hoped and Addie is now 26 ½ inches long and weighs 15 pounds 10 ½ ounces! She cried during all four of her vaccinations but was "all better" as soon as I picked her up. Dr. Dudgeon told us that if Addie starts showing any signs of delay to bring her back in six weeks; otherwise we're all clear until her nine-month check-up! I told him I didn't plan on seeing him again for three months...
